Global positioning system to manage risk for POS terminal
First Claim
1. A system for processing financial transactions comprising:
- at least one remote terminal that identifies the location of a financial transaction, wherein the remote terminal also acquires transaction information about a proffered promissory payment and transmits a signal indicative of the transaction information and the location information; and
an authorizing host that receives the signal transmitted by the remote terminal wherein the authorizing host evaluates the risk associated with the financial transaction based, at least in part, on the location information so as to determine whether to accept or decline the financial transaction, and wherein the authorizing host transmits a signal back to the remote terminal indicative of acceptance or decline of the proffered promissory payment.

Abstract
The present teachings describe a system for processing financial transactions. In one embodiment, the system includes a remote terminal adapted to identify the location of financial transactions via global positioning system (GPS) information such that the remote terminal acquires transaction information from a user and transmits a first signal indicative of transaction information and GPS information. In addition, the system includes an authorizing host adapted to receive the first signal transmitted by the remote terminal such that the authorizing host evaluates the risk associated with financial transactions based, at least in part, on the GPS information so as to determine whether to accept or decline the financial transaction. The present teachings further describe devices and methods of acquiring GPS information for the purpose of managing risk for financial transactions.
